Hearth Installation in Denver, CO
Hearth installation services encompass the setup and integration of fireplaces into residential properties, including both traditional and modern designs. These projects often involve installing wood-burning, gas, or electric hearths, as well as constructing or modifying masonry surrounds, mantels, and hearths to complement the interior decor. Homeowners typically seek this service when adding a new fireplace feature, upgrading an existing one, or customizing a space to enhance comfort and aesthetic appeal.
Before requesting hearth install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including any necessary preparations such as chimney or venting modifications, and the materials required. It’s also common to inquire about the compatibility of different hearth types with existing structures and the potential need for permits or inspections.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project aligns with safety standards and personal preferences.

Common Hearth Installation Jobs
Fireplace Installations - designed to add warmth and ambiance to living spaces.
Wood Stove Installations - provide efficient heating options for homes and cabins.
Gas Fireplace Installations - offer convenient and clean heating solutions.
Electric Fireplace Installations - add a realistic fire feature without venting requirements.
Indoor Hearth Installations - enhance room aesthetics with functional and stylish hearths.
Outdoor Fireplace Installations - create inviting outdoor living areas for gatherings.
Hearth Installation Questions
What types of hearths are available for installation? There are various options including traditional wood-burning, gas, and electric hearths to suit different preferences and home setups.
Can a hearth be installed in any room? Hearths are typically installed in living rooms, family rooms, or dens where a fireplace or heating feature is desired.
What should property owners consider before installing a hearth? It's important to evaluate the space, ventilation requirements, and the intended fuel source for safety and proper function.
Is professional installation necessary for a hearth? Yes, professional installation ensures the hearth is safely and correctly installed according to building codes and manufacturer guidelines.
